OBS streaming using Cubase audio

Just an example if you have an audio interface with loopback ability.
This is without using Cubase’s Control Room so that it works in every version.

I create an output bus “To OBS” in Audio Connections. This gets connected to the stereo channel pair of my audio interface where I have activated loopback. In this example Adat 5 & 6.

If I only use 1 audio track I can use a Sends slot to send the signal to the “To OBS” bus. In OBS I will choose the pyhsical input from my audio interface where loopback is enabled. In this example Adat 5 & 6.

If you have several tracks you can route them all to a group track and use a Sends slot there.

If you have a version of Cubase that support “Direct Routing” you can use that instead of the Sends slot.
